Trying to find out if column lock fix has been applied to my recently purchased 2000. With key out steering wheel does not lock. So I checked under passenger floor board, doesn't look like popular lock fix has been installed. After turning car off and removing key I do hear something happening in the steering column like something running for a split second. Can I assume that the lock plate has been removed or should I go ahead and install lock fix under passenger floor board??

If you hear the electric lock when it's turned off but wheel doesn't lock then some type of bypass / fix has been installed.

Just because your steering wheel doesnt lock, doed NOT make you safe from a column lock related issue. If the column lock system only has the dealer installed FIX,,, One day you will get into your car, start it up and go to leave and once the car moves, the engine will SHUT DOWN on the new dealer installed 2 MPH column lock fuel safety cut off....
You must install a proper column lock bypass to be free.
